The Eviction Notice Vermont Without Tenancy Agreement serves as a legal tool for tenants to address potential retaliatory eviction actions from landlords. This form outlines the tenant's rights under Vermont law, emphasizing that landlords cannot retaliate against tenants for making complaints about health or safety violations or for participating in tenant organizations. Key features of the form include sections for the tenant to specify their address, the nature of the landlord's retaliatory actions, and a demand for the withdrawal of the eviction notice. Filling out the form requires users to clearly identify the landlord's actions perceived as retaliatory, and the completion of a proof of delivery section ensures that the notice is properly served. The notice must describe the offense and include the number (#) of days the tenant must respond. If the tenant does not adhere to the notice, the landlord may submit an eviction case (Ejectment) at the Superior Court, Civil Division.

Your landlord cannot make you leave your home without giving you the appropriate notice. The notice period is usually four months, however sometimes this can be reduced to 2-4 weeks in serious cases.

To start a case, you must file a complaint with the court. In that complaint, you can ask for an eviction order. You must file your complaint no more than 60 days after the end date listed in your notice to the tenant. You will be the plaintiff and the tenant will be the defendant.

The Governor of Vermont let the state of emergency expire on June 15, 2021. This does not mean that you can be removed from your rental unit right away. You cannot be evicted from your home without a court process.
